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| more documentation improvements; fixes #9119 | Araq | 2018-09-29 | 1 | -1/+1 |
| | |||||
* | Merge pull request #9084 from demotomohiro/fixman | Andreas Rumpf | 2018-09-28 | 1 | -1/+1 |
|\ | | | | | manual: fix typo in 'Pre-defined integer types' | ||||
| * | manual: fix typo in 'Pre-defined integer types' | demotomohiro | 2018-09-28 | 1 | -1/+1 |
| | | |||||
* | | manual: fix the layout | Araq | 2018-09-27 | 1 | -5/+5 |
| | | |||||
* | | manual: fixes the wording of case statement macros | Araq | 2018-09-27 | 1 | -3/+3 |
|/ | |||||
* | manual updates; document magical system.procCall; fixes #4329 | Andreas Rumpf | 2018-09-17 | 1 | -24/+40 |
| | |||||
* | Merge pull request #8806 from awr1/add-reorder-to-docs | Andreas Rumpf | 2018-09-15 | 1 | -49/+105 |
|\ | | | | | [Docs] Added {.experimental: "codeReordering".} to manual | ||||
| * | fixed language wrt initialization | awr | 2018-09-12 | 1 | -4/+4 |
| | | |||||
| * | whoops, forgot to remove old pragma section | awr | 2018-09-07 | 1 | -4/+1 |
| | | |||||
| * | changed to {.experimental: codeReordering.}, postpoing declared() stuff | awr | 2018-09-06 | 1 | -97/+105 |
| | | |||||
| * | updated manual for declared() | awr | 2018-09-04 | 1 | -0/+14 |
| | | |||||
| * | [Docs] Added {.reorder.} to manual | awr | 2018-08-29 | 1 | -40/+77 |
| | | |||||
* | | manual: add a note about the terminating zero for strings; refs #5596 | Araq | 2018-09-03 | 1 | -0/+5 |
| | | |||||
* | | manual: more documentation for the 'using' statement; closes #8565 | Araq | 2018-09-03 | 1 | -2/+8 |
| | | |||||
* | | manual: document the 'unsafeAddr' operator; closes #5038 | Araq | 2018-09-03 | 1 | -0/+13 |
| | | |||||
* | | document 'var T' and 'typedesc' restriction in generics; closes #1156 | Araq | 2018-09-03 | 1 | -0/+28 |
| | | |||||
* | | fixes #8797 | Araq | 2018-09-03 | 1 | -2/+2 |
| | | |||||
* | | Improve enumerate macro (#8819) | Vindaar | 2018-08-31 | 1 | -8/+12 |
| | | | | | | | | | | | | | | | | * fix case macro manual entry to produce code block Previously line breaks were so weird that the code blocks were not created. * improve `enumerate` for loop macro by wrapping in block | ||||
* | | fixes #8066 | Araq | 2018-08-31 | 1 | -7/+18 |
| | | |||||
* | | manual: document the order of evaluation | Araq | 2018-08-27 | 1 | -0/+49 |
| | | |||||
* | | allow .experimental in a .push/pop environment; refs #8676 | Araq | 2018-08-27 | 1 | -1/+25 |
| | | |||||
* | | Added to docs: warning string for {.deprecated.} pragma (#8783) | awr1 | 2018-08-26 | 1 | -1/+5 |
| | | |||||
* | | Fixes #8766 (#8769) | hlaaf | 2018-08-24 | 1 | -1/+1 |
|/ | |||||
* | implements 'case statement macros' in order to encourage the development of ↵ | Andreas Rumpf | 2018-08-16 | 1 | -0/+52 |
| | | | | pattern matching mechanisms that are not terrible to look at | ||||
* | put the new for loop macros under an experimental switch named 'forLoopMacros' | Andreas Rumpf | 2018-08-15 | 1 | -0/+5 |
| | |||||
* | renames threadpool.await to blockUntil; refs #7853 | Araq | 2018-08-14 | 1 | -3/+3 |
| | |||||
* | Merge branch 'araq-misc' of github.com:nim-lang/Nim into araq-misc | Andreas Rumpf | 2018-08-10 | 1 | -1/+2 |
|\ | |||||
| * | rename SystemError to CatchableError in order to avoid breaking Nimble and ↵ | Araq | 2018-08-10 | 1 | -1/+2 |
| | | | | | | | | probably lots of other code | ||||
* | | Merge branch 'devel' into araq-misc | Andreas Rumpf | 2018-08-10 | 1 | -1/+2 |
|\ \ | |/ |/| | |||||
| * | fixes #8519; implements T.distinctBase to reverse T = distinct A (#8531) | Timothee Cour | 2018-08-10 | 1 | -1/+2 |
| | | |||||
* | | rework the exception hierarchy; refs #8363 | Andreas Rumpf | 2018-08-10 | 1 | -3/+6 |
| | | |||||
* | | update the 'float' spec; refs #8589 | Andreas Rumpf | 2018-08-10 | 1 | -2/+2 |
| | | |||||
* | | deprecated regionized pointers | Araq | 2018-08-10 | 1 | -62/+0 |
| | | |||||
* | | deprecate the .this pragma | Araq | 2018-08-09 | 1 | -0/+2 |
|/ | |||||
* | Deprecate the dot style for import paths (#8474) | Oscar Nihlgård | 2018-07-30 | 1 | -11/+12 |
| | |||||
* | manual.rst: fixes a typo | Andreas Rumpf | 2018-07-17 | 1 | -1/+1 |
| | |||||
* | make tests green again | Andreas Rumpf | 2018-07-06 | 1 | -1/+1 |
| | |||||
* | Deprecate 'c', 'C' prefix for octal literals, fixes #8082 (#8178) | Vindaar | 2018-07-03 | 1 | -2/+2 |
| | | | | | | | | | | | | | | | * deprecate `0c`, `0C` prefix for octal literals Deprecates the previously allowed syntax of `0c` and `0C` as a prefix for octal literals to bring the literals in line with the behavior of `parseOct` from parseutils. * add `msgKind` arg to `lexMessageLitNum` for deprecation messages * change literal tests to check all valid integer literals Also adds the `tinvaligintegerlit3` test to test for the (still) invalid `0O` prefix. | ||||
* | Clarify use of special `:` for passing a block of stmts to template (#8133) | Kaushal Modi | 2018-06-27 | 1 | -5/+5 |
| | | | Fixes https://github.com/nim-lang/Nim/issues/8131. | ||||
* | Merge pull request #7736 from cooldome/range_float_type | Andreas Rumpf | 2018-06-27 | 1 | -3/+7 |
|\ | | | | | Language feature: range float types | ||||
| * | style fixes, typos | cooldome | 2018-06-12 | 1 | -1/+1 |
| | | |||||
| * | merge devel | cooldome | 2018-06-10 | 1 | -5/+9 |
| |\ | |||||
| * \ | Merge branch 'devel' into range_float_type | cooldome | 2018-04-30 | 1 | -6/+6 |
| |\ \ | |||||
| * | | | update the doc | cooldome | 2018-04-29 | 1 | -3/+7 |
| | | | | |||||
* | | | | requested pull-request changes | Zahary Karadjov | 2018-06-16 | 1 | -4/+4 |
| | | | | |||||
* | | | | document the new `type[T]` and `static[T]` features | Zahary Karadjov | 2018-06-16 | 1 | -65/+91 |
| | | | | |||||
* | | | | document the 'pkg' and 'std' pseudo directories; closes #7250 | Araq | 2018-06-14 | 1 | -10/+29 |
| |_|/ |/| | | |||||
* | | | Fixed operator precedence in example (#7912) | Chris McIntyre | 2018-06-01 | 1 | -1/+1 |
| | | | | | | | | | The order of operations was incorrect for the right-hand side of the `assert` statement on line 3199, based on the operator precedence for line 3197. | ||||
* | | | Removed space between "array" and a square bracket in the docs | data-man | 2018-05-19 | 1 | -2/+2 |
| | | | |||||
* | | | implement the export/except statement | Zahary Karadjov | 2018-05-07 | 1 | -0/+3 |
| | | |